Outside back cover : "This work presents a radical new view of the function of the brain and nervous system. It suggests that the nervous system in each individual operates as a selective system resembling natural selection in evolution but operating different mechanisms. By providing a fundamental neural basis for categorization of the things of the world it unifies perception, action and learning. This theory revises our view of memory, considering it as a dynamic process of recategorization which has implications for the various psychological states from attention to dreaming. It will stimulate discussion about the mind-body problem, the origins of knowledge and the perceptual bases of language. The author won the 1972 Nobel Prize for Physiology of Medicine."

Models and concepts of brain function have always been guided and limited by the available techniques and data. This book brings together a multitude of data from different backgrounds. It addresses questions such as: how do different brain areas interact in the process of channelling information? How do neuronal populations encode the information? How are networks formed and separated or associated with other networks? The authors present data at the single cell level both in vitro and in vivo, at the neuronal population level in vivo comparing field potentials (EEGs) in different brain areas, and also present data from spike recordings from identified neuronal populations during the performance of different tasks. Written for academic researchers and graduate students, the book strives to cover the range of single cell activity analysis to the observation of network activity, and finally to brain area activity and cognitive processes of the brain.
